Abstract
Purpose To investigate the comprehensive value of dynamic contrast enhanced MRI in diagnosing breast lesions. Methods Eighty two patients (81 women,1 man) suspicious of breast tumors were recruited into this study to undergo dynamic contrast enhanced MRI prospectively. MRI diagnosis of these lesions were based on the morphology,enhancement mode,time signal intensity curve and the combination of the above. Results The study population consisted of 82 cases with 56 malignant tumors and 26 benign lesions. The sensitivity and specificity for detection and characterization of breast lesions based on the morphology,enhanced mode,time signal intensity curve and the combination of three parameters were 82.9% and 76.9%,70.7% and 65.4%,87.8% and 80.8%,and 92.7% and 92.3% respectively. Conclusion The dynamic contrast enhanced MRI could be of great value in diagnosing breast lesions.
